- Imran Abbas was born on 15 October 1982 in Islamabad, Pakistan. He is an actor, known for Ae Dil Hai Mushkil (2016), Khuda Aur Muhabbat (2016) and Akbari Asghari (2011).

Haider Ali is a singer-songwriter, and an art director, also known as haidertonight.
Haider Ali was born on July 12, 1994 in Islamabad, Pakistan. The son of a professional interior designer and artist [mother], and a marketer and general contractor [father]. He is of Southern Asian, Persian, and Italian descent. Ali has two older sisters and a younger brother. He grew up in a receptive, disciplined, yet contemporary family system. Ali often found himself drawing imaginary things in thin air that he would later put onto a piece of paper, a knack for art that he got from his mother from a very young age. Bored and unmotivated at the Army Public School (APS), the young Ali was a rather shy and sensitive child who found a safe haven in art and music classes, and his interest later sprouted into a full-time career. Ali was only eleven years old when he first began taking guitar and singing lessons - after which most of his musical edification came from the books of the legendary British author and BBC World Service producer Nick Freeth. Ali was also in a few bands as a teenager with his younger brother - one being Dying Desperation and another, Through Tonight. Ali recognizes Michael Jackson and Metallica as having been his musical influences as a child, with James Hetfield, Pete Loeffler, and Slash being the reason he wanted to play the guitar.
Starting on the stage at the age of 15, Ali made his live debut on May 4, 2010, for a British Council charity event in Islamabad, Pakistan, raising money for the orphans of the devastating earthquake that shook Southern Asia in 2005. For his contribution to the relief efforts, Ali was given the award of appreciation by the director of British Council program development and occupied territories, Martin Daltry. Having won the award, Ali became inspired to get engaged in humanitarian causes and raised awareness for climate change, taking significant action with the help of the Youth Parliament of Pakistan and the British Council, he was able to make a positive impact on habitat management, native tree restoration, and environmental damage control projects in the local communities.
After performing a series of local and national shows during the summer of 2011 - Ali recorded his debut single titled "Missing Puzzle" with Dying Desperation. The single was released on December 14, 2011, and received positive praise from fans and critics alike. It was the beginning of Ali's newfound recognition as a prominent young talent, but his rise to fame was about to take a major halt. On October 28, 2012, Ali suffered a spinal cord (lumbar vertebrae) fracture during a Jiu-jitsu training session, followed by a 5th metacarpal fracture on his right hand due to punching a door just a month later. Being unable to play the guitar and or perform day-to-day activities, the succession of critical injuries forced Ali to go on a hiatus, one which would subsequently put him through a lengthy period of anxiety and depression.
Though having mental and physical constraints, Ali was still able to fight through and used the healing phase to his advantage by focusing on his education and finished graduating from Capital University (CU) in March 2014. During the two-year haul, Ali also rekindled his passion for art through the medium of photography and participated in the prestigious International Photography Awards (IPA) in July 2015, and won two Honorable Mention Award(s) commissioned by the chair of the jury committee (IPA), Susan Baraz, and president (IPA), Hossein Farmani, within the Architecture-Industrial and Fine Art-Still Life categories respectively.
Inspired by his experience, Ali took a step back to hone his artistic skills by shifting the creative focus to be more honest. And with this came a new perspective for the young artist as he decided to attend Michigan State University (MSU) to earn a diploma in professional photography in April 2016, followed by another diploma in graphic design from the California Institute of Arts (CalArts) in October 2017. Coming out with freshly acquired skills, Ali found himself experimenting with photography and design elements, and he was able to create his distinctive style in the process - which landed his photography a feature at the first annual Coursera Capstone Alumni - Kresge Art Center exhibit on November 29, 2016, hosted by professor photography (MFA), Syracuse University (SU), Peter Glendinning, and associate professor photography (DMA), University of Illinois (UIUC), Mark Sullivan, at Michigan State University (MSU). Ali's photograph titled "Tanning Egg" was featured at the exhibit among the works of 127 photographers from 39 countries. On June 9, 2017, Ali was featured on the Coursera Blog - Learner Story series for his outstanding achievements in professional photography and graphic design specializations from Michigan State University (MSU) and the California Institute of Arts (CalArts) - making him an artist worth noticing.
Having come to understand his perceived calling as the voice for the voiceless within his generation, Ali has continued utilizing key examples taken from his own life experiences. Though shared emotional semblance, Ali discloses his struggles, fears, and insecurities in the hopes of igniting a universal connection with his followers as he seeks to open the doors for his genuine sound and show who he truly is as an artist. Fayyaz Baig is a Filmmaker from Islamabad. He started his film career as a talent Coordinator for Film Parchi(2018) after pursuing graduation in Media and Communication. He worked as a Costume Designer in Sherdil(2019) and Heer Maan Ja(2019).
